Violence , there are four categories according to Galtung . First , violence direct violence which refers to the act of violence is physical or psychological attack someone directly . Are included in this category are all forms of murder homocide and also all forms of forced or violent acts that cause physical and psychological suffering , such as forced evictions , kidnapping , torture , and rape . Second , indirect violence indirect violence which acts harmful to humans , sometimes even to kill , but does not involve a direct relationship between the victim and those responsible for the violence . Third , the repressive violence repressive violence is violent , although not dangerous to human life , but it is a gross violation of the curb freedom , human dignity , and equal rights for every human being . This repressive violence associated with the civil rights , such as freedom of thought , freedom of movement , and equality before the law . Fourth , violence alienatif Universitas Sumatera Utara 10 alienating violence which refers to the abrogation of individual rights is higher , such as the right emotional development , cultural , and intellectual . One form of violence alienatif is ethnocide , that is, policies or actions that change the material or social conditions to be under a certain cultural identity groups , such as the problem of racism.
